Business Case for Gate 2 Review

A business case is a tool that supports planning and decision-making, in this case, whether to move forward with this Level 2 or Level 3 project.  It answers the question "What are the financial benefits, opportunities, or weaknesses of approving this project?"  A good business case shows expected financial consequences of the project over time and includes the methods and rationale that were used for quantifying benefits and costs.  The business case is not a budget or a management accounting report or a financial reporting statement. 

Business case development is a step organizations use for project selection, funding, and prioritization. It analyzes how the project will be used to implement the State of Michigan IT strategy.  It tells the story of why the project is critical to the Department of Information Technology mission.

Completing the Business Case is required for Level 2 and Level 3 projects.  This document is to be submitted to the Project Board along with the Project Charter and Project Schedule at Gate 2.  The Business Case Template is available for use and the User Guide is available for reference below.
